What Does the ‘Kill Zone’ Mean for Ethereum Investors? The “Kill Zone” refers to a specific price range where investors believe Ethereum is most likely to bounce back or rally following a dip. Identifying this zone can be essential for those looking to optimize their buying strategies. Analysts frequently highlight these areas in price charts, offering investors a chance to enter the market at a lower cost with the potential for significant returns. How Can You Determine the Best Times to Buy Ethereum? Determining when to enter the market requires a keen understanding of price action and market sentiment. Keep an eye on key support levels and resistances to help delineate these zones. Tools like TradingView are invaluable here, allowing you to visualize price patterns and apply various technical indicators to find your ideal buy point. Moreover, it’s essential to stay updated on Ethereum news and the broader market dynamics. Factors like regulatory changes, technological upgrades, and shifts in investor sentiment can all impact the timing of your investments.
